Explain briefly Common sub expression elimination of the commonly used code optimization techniques.
Common sub expression elimination:
In given expression as "(a+b)-(a+b)/4", in such "common sub-expression" termed to the duplicated "(a+b)". Compilers implementing such technique realize that "(a+b)" would not modify, and by itself, only compute its value once and use similar value next time.
